You can look perfect. You can have the career, the style, the smile, and the relationship that others envy. And still, you can be living in silence, breaking a little more each day.
Behind too many polished appearances lies a truth that few dare to speak. Emotional abuse does not always leave bruises. Sometimes it hides behind love. Behind luxury. Behind the person who claims to care for you the most.
In A Prison in High Heels, Michelle Lapointe exposes the painful truth about toxic relationships and the emotional prisons that hold women captive. Through raw honesty, deep understanding, and empowering guidance, she reveals how to break free from the cycle of control, self-doubt, and emotional manipulation that keeps so many women trapped.
This book is not about blame. It is about freedom. It is about learning to see clearly, choosing yourself, and walking away from love that hurts.
Inside this powerful guide, you will discover:How to recognize the subtle patterns of emotional and psychological abuse that disguise themselves as love or attention
Why women stay in toxic relationships, even when they know something is wrong
How to detach from manipulation and begin rebuilding your confidence and independence
The emotional stages of leaving, healing, and rediscovering who you are without fear or guilt
Proven strategies to restore your boundaries, your self-worth, and your peace of mind
How to love again, trust again, and create a life rooted in truth and wholeness
